My local shop, Eurosport, is now selling Bimota. They have two DB6 Delirios on the floor right now with a Tesi 3D on the way. The DB6 is powered by the Ducati 1000DS engine and is limited to 50 bikes worldwide with a price of $29,400.

The white bike is going to the shop owners wife.


This is the grey one on the floor. You sit in this bike.
